Shop millions of independent artists.   Independent.   Together.

The End

Steve Taylor

|

#852 of 3133

|

The End Digital Art

Comments

Post a Comment

Cedar City, UT - United States

A creative and thought provoking image Steve!...F/L

Middleboro, MA - United States

This is cool Steve! l/f